本申請涉及電子顯示相關的,具體涉及一種驅動電子顯示設備圖像的刷新方法。
背景技術:
1、電子紙顯示屏是一種特殊類型的電子顯示設備,具有獨特的顯示刷新機制,是一種被動刷新機制,只有當圖像數據需要更新時系統才會刷新屏幕顯示新圖像。最初,電子紙顯示屏只能進行黑白顯示,由于傳輸的數據少,能夠全局刷新來顯示新圖像,圖像更新的整體時間短且不會占用大量的傳輸通道資源。當前,電子紙顯示屏已經從最初的黑白顯示發展為支持多種顏色顯示,如三色、四色和六色等,這種顯示多應用電子書,書內插畫或靜態廣告等對電子紙顯示圖像顏色要求較高的場景,隨之而來的是圖像傳輸數據增大,占用大量的傳輸通道資源的問題。傳統的電子紙顯示屏硬件不適合如今多種顏色圖像的傳輸需求,現階段,主要是借助對主控芯片、顯示驅動芯片等硬件進行升級改造的方式來提升全局刷新效率,這一過程涉及復雜的硬件研發,不但會增加成本,還可能引發兼容性問題,而且仍然會占用大量的傳輸通道資料,能耗大,對用戶體驗也會造成影響。
技術實現思路
1、本申請通過提供了一種驅動電子顯示設備圖像的刷新方法,旨在解決現有技術驅動圖像刷新時成本高、能耗大,因兼容性問題對用戶體驗造成影響的問題。
2、本申請公開的第一個方面,提供了一種驅動電子顯示設備圖像的刷新方法,所述電子顯示設備包括電子紙顯示屏,所述方法包括:
3、獲取待顯示圖像,判斷所述待顯示圖像為非黑白圖像,得到目標圖像,其中,所述待顯示圖像為文字和/或圖片組合形成的靜態圖像;將所述目標圖像輸入圖像檢測模型的圖像分割單元內,獲得k個目標分割圖像及圖像位置標識,將所述k個目標分割圖像輸入圖像檢測模型的哈希算法檢測單元內,通過bmh哈希算法得到k個目標分割圖像的哈希值;遍歷所述圖像位置標識,計算每個圖像位置標識下的目標分割圖像哈希值和當前分割圖像哈希值的漢明距離,將漢明距離與圖像位置標識一一映射,通過預設的第一閾值對漢明距離進行預檢,得到m個預檢結果和n個待二次檢測結果,其中,m和n分別為≥0的整數,且m+n=k;將所述n個待二次檢測結果的圖像位置標識定義為二次檢測位置標識,將所述二次檢測位置標識按其對應的漢明距離升序排列,得到預檢檢測序列,集合所述二次檢測位置標識下的當前分割圖像,與所述待二次檢查結果組成成對分割圖像,得到二次識別圖像集;分別通過直方圖法、結構相似性指數和特征點匹配法對所述二次識別圖像集中的各成對分割圖像進行差異檢測,將所述二次檢測位置標識按其對應的檢測結果升序排列,分別得到第一檢測序列、第二檢測序列和第三檢測序列;以所述預檢檢測序列為基準,遍歷二次檢測位置標識,計算其在第一檢測序列中排序提升的總步數,得到第一差異度評分,以第一檢測序列為基準,遍歷二次檢測位置標識,計算其在第二檢測序列中排序提升的總步數,得到第二差異度評分,以第二檢測序列為基準,遍歷二次檢測位置標識,計算其在第三檢測序列中排序提升的總步數,得到第三差異度評分;將所述第一差異度評分、第二差異度評分和第三差異度評分同步至差異度分析模型,獲得二次識別圖像集的差異度分析值,其中,所述差異度分析模型以多元回歸模型為架構,以三個差異度評分作為輸入,以差異度分析值作為輸出;判斷所述差異度分析值大于預設的第二閾值,剔除重復圖像,得到p個二次檢測結果,p≤n;判斷m+p的結果是否小于預設的第三閾值,若是,驅動總控芯片生成局部刷新驅動指令,驅動顯示驅動芯片將該指令的控制信號轉換為相應的電壓波形,驅動電子紙顯示屏按照該指令對應的電壓波形進行局部圖像刷新,顯示目標圖像;若否,驅動總控芯片生成全局刷新驅動指令,驅動顯示驅動芯片將該指令的控制信號轉換為相應的電壓波形,驅動電子紙顯示屏按照該指令對應的電壓波形進行全局圖像刷新,顯示目標圖像。
4、本申請中提供的一個或多個技術方案,至少具有如下技術效果或優點:
5、獲取待顯示圖像,判斷待顯示圖像為非黑白圖像,得到目標圖像,能夠避免不必要的圖像差異判斷,分流執行驅動電子顯示設備圖像的刷新方法,提高刷新整體效率;將目標圖像輸入圖像檢測模型內,獲得k個目標分割圖像,進行預檢,獲得m個預檢結果和n個待二次檢測結果,快速識別出需要進行多元視覺檢測的目標分割圖像,提高圖像檢測的準確性和減小系統的計算量,提高刷新整體效率;構建預檢檢測序列和二次識別圖像集,在二次識別圖集中進行進一步圖像差異識別,目標明確又縮小范圍,提高檢測效率;獲得第一檢測序列、第二檢測序列和第三檢測序列,更全面捕捉到成對分割圖像間的差異,增強了檢測的全面性;通過第一差異度評分、第二差異度評分和第三差異度評分,反映了成對分割圖像在不同的視覺檢測技術下的差異程度,有助于綜合評估二次識別圖像集中成對分割圖像的整體差異情況;通過差異度分析模型,對第一差異度評分、第二差異度評分和第三差異度評分進行多元回歸綜合判斷,將分散的差異度評分綜合起來得到二次識別圖像集的差異度分析值,提高了對二次識別圖像集中成對分割圖像的判斷準確性;判斷差異度分析值大于預設的第二閾值,得到p個第二檢測結果;判斷m+p的結果是否小于第三閾值,通過判斷結果來驅動總控芯片生成相應的驅動指令,驅動顯示驅動芯片將相應驅動指令的控制信號轉換為相應的電壓波形,驅動電子紙顯示屏按照相應驅動指令對應的刷新策略進行圖像刷新,更新顯示圖像,最小化不必要的刷新操作。本發明用一種更為簡單、方便且成本更低的方法最小化占用傳輸通道資源進而減少資源消耗,提高驅動電子紙顯示屏圖像的刷新整體效率。
1.一種驅動電子顯示設備圖像的刷新方法,其特征在于,所述電子顯示設備包括電子紙顯示屏,所述方法包括:
2.如權利要求1所述的驅動電子顯示設備圖像的刷新方法,其特征在于,獲得k個目標分割圖像及圖像位置標識,包括:
3.如權利要求1所述的驅動電子顯示設備圖像的刷新方法,其特征在于,將所述目標圖像輸入圖像檢測模型的圖像分割單元內之前,包括:
4.如權利要求3所述的驅動電子顯示設備圖像的刷新方法,其特征在于,通過預設的第一閾值對漢明距離進行預檢,得到m個預檢結果和n個待二次檢測結果,包括:
5.如權利要求1所述的驅動電子顯示設備圖像的刷新方法,其特征在于,分別得到第一檢測序列、第二檢測序列和第三檢測序列,包括:
6.如權利要求1所述的驅動電子顯示設備圖像的刷新方法,其特征在于,所述第一差異度評分、第二差異度評分和第三差異度評分,包括:
7.如權利要求1所述的驅動電子顯示設備圖像的刷新方法,其特征在于,差異度分析模型,包括:
8.如權利要求1所述的驅動電子顯示設備圖像的刷新方法,其特征在于,得到p個第二檢測結果,包括: